How do you organize the inside of a greenhouse?
To organize your DIY backyard greenhouse, consider installing wire mesh, galvanized metal, or slatted shelves along the sides for easy access and airflow. Consider a multi-tiered shelving system to maximize vertical space. Arrange plants on shelves based on their light requirements. Common types of greenhouse shelves include wire mesh shelves, which are ideal for moisture-sensitive plants, and slatted shelves, which are ideal for plants that prefer well-drained conditions.
These shelves allow sunlight to reach every leaf, ensuring proper airflow and drainage for your plants. By incorporating these shelves into your greenhouse, you can create a happy and functional greenhouse environment.

How do you maximize space in a greenhouse?
Maximizing space in your greenhouse can be achieved by growing upwards using sturdy shelving units or vertical planters. Keder Greenhouse recommends the built-in side staging option, which features an adjustable height shelf, ideal for plants like strawberries, tomatoes, and herbs. Vertical gardening not only saves ground space but also enhances airflow and light distribution. Before planting, plan your layout by sketching a floor plan and grouping plants with similar light and water requirements.
The north side of the greenhouse is recommended for taller plants needing less sunlight, while the south side is for shorter, sun-loving plants. Investing in multi-functional benches and shelves can also help keep your greenhouse organized and free up more growing space.
How do you layout the inside of a greenhouse?
The universal layout for a greenhouse is to place one row of benches or plants along each longer wall and a third row in the middle if space allows. A greenhouse bench is essentially a table, and can be repurposed or used as a bench. It’s important to avoid wood as it can rot over time. Thinner rows or benches are acceptable for smaller greenhouses. When arranging the greenhouse, leave at least 19 inches (48 cm) of space between rows of furniture and/or plants for a comfortable path. If you frequently carry equipment or pots, leave at least 24 inches (61 cm) of space between rows. If not using rows, it may take longer to move between ends of the greenhouse.

What does a greenhouse need inside?
The greenhouse is a crucial part of any indoor growing adventure, and it’s essential to consider various aspects such as lighting, temperature and humidity control, watering, sanitation, and bench types. Some greenhouse hobbyists prefer using biodegradable pots and store them in water-tight containers. Growing mediums can be mixed in buckets with lids in small greenhouses or stored in large plastic tubs with lids in larger greenhouses. Benches are also essential for keeping plants off the ground and should be painted with semi-gloss paint to protect against mold.
Sanitation is vital in a greenhouse, as it prevents the growth of fungus, bacteria, or bugs. Bleach and disinfectant spray are essential, along with sinks and large washing tubs. Irrigation and drainage are also crucial, with benches designed with holes or slats to allow water to drip through. Ventilation is essential, with some greenhouses requiring vents to release built-up heat and humidity in the summer.
Artificial lighting is necessary for proper lighting, and fluorescent lights can be used if plants need longer days or are not naturally lit. Shades are also important for shade-loving plants, and shade cloths help keep the hottest rays out of the building.
Climate control is essential for greenhouses, with heaters and fans being cost-effective options for small spaces. It’s essential to use thermometers and hygrometers with a climate control system for precise control.
